| Charging Ports | 16+2 bays for AA, AAA, and 9V rechargeable batteries |
| Charging Time | Up to 5.5 hours for AA/AAA, 2.4 hours for 9V Li-ion, 3 hours for 9V Ni-MH batteries |
| Supported Battery Types | Ni-MH, Ni-Cd, Li-ion (9V only), non-rechargeable batteries detected and stopped |
| Protection Features | Overcharge, overcurrent, overvoltage, overheating, and short circuit protection |
| Display | Smart LCD screen showing real-time charging status |
| Compatibility Note | Not compatible with AA or AAA lithium batteries |

Are There Any Common Issues to Watch Out for with 16 Port Battery Chargers?
When considering the best 16 port battery chargers, there are several common issues that users should be aware of:
- Overheating: Many users report that 16 port battery chargers can generate significant heat, especially when all ports are in use simultaneously. This can lead to potential damage to the charger or connected batteries if not designed with adequate heat dissipation features.
- Charging Speed: The charging speed can vary greatly among different models, with some failing to provide sufficient power to charge multiple batteries efficiently. Users should look for chargers that offer fast charging capabilities to ensure that all batteries are charged in a timely manner.
- Compatibility Issues: Not all chargers are compatible with every type of battery. Some may only work with specific brands or battery chemistry, so it’s crucial to check compatibility before purchase to avoid damaging batteries or the charger itself.
- Build Quality: The construction quality of the charger is an important factor, as lower-quality models may not withstand everyday use. A sturdy charger will have better longevity and performance, reducing the likelihood of malfunction or failure.
- Port Reliability: With 16 ports, there can be variability in the reliability of each port. Some users have experienced issues with certain ports failing to charge properly or not making a good connection, which can be frustrating in a multi-battery setup.
- Power Supply Requirements: Certain 16 port chargers may require a dedicated power source to function effectively and may not work well with standard household outlets. Users should ensure they have the appropriate electrical setup to support the charger’s power demands.
How Should You Properly Maintain Your 16 Port Battery Charger for Longevity?
Proper maintenance of your 16 port battery charger is essential for ensuring its longevity and optimal performance.
- Regular Cleaning: Dust and debris can accumulate in and around the charger, affecting performance.
- Use Appropriate Cables: Using the right cables for your devices can prevent damage to both the charger and the batteries.
- Monitor Charging Cycles: Overcharging can lead to battery degradation, so it’s important to keep track of charging cycles.
- Temperature Control: Ensure the charger operates in a cool, dry environment to prevent overheating.
- Periodic Inspection: Regularly check for any signs of wear or damage to the charger and its components.
Regular cleaning involves dusting off the ports and the surface of the charger to prevent buildup that can interfere with electrical connections. Additionally, you should ensure that the charger is unplugged before cleaning to avoid any electrical hazards.
Using appropriate cables is crucial as mismatched or low-quality cables can lead to inconsistent charging, overheating, or even short-circuiting. Always opt for cables that are recommended by the manufacturer to ensure compatibility and safety.
Monitoring charging cycles helps in preventing overcharging, which can shorten battery life significantly. Many chargers come with built-in indicators that show when batteries are fully charged, so be sure to utilize these features.
Temperature control is vital since excessive heat can damage the internal components of the charger and the batteries being charged. Keep the charger in a well-ventilated area and avoid placing it in direct sunlight or near heat sources.
Periodic inspections should be part of your maintenance routine to identify any signs of wear, such as frayed wires or loose connections. Addressing these issues promptly can prevent further damage and ensure the continued safe operation of your charger.
